This is a secondary route used by Norfolk Southern. Running 87 miles between Morristown TN and Salisbury NC, coal trains to West Virginia, North Carolina, and Kentucky are common. Most manifest run daily including 135 and have a variety of mixed frieght cars. Though intermodal does not run this route, the variety are frieght and scenery make up for it. Locals are another common sight on this route running back and forth. Engines to include would be a sd70ace, dash 9, and es44ac. Here a es44ac merges off the s line. Norfolk Southern 4003 and 4005 pull a coal train close to Del Rio. Last, Norfolk Southern 1070 and sd80mac 7217 on the Bridgeport Tennessee sidetrack I caught back in September.
